Tasks
-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local regulations related to transportation engineering. -Design and develop transportation infrastructure, including roads, highways, bridges, and traffic management systems. -Assist in project management tasks, including cost estimation, scheduling, and resource allocation. -Provide technical support and guidance to junior engineers and other team members. -Prepare detailed engineering reports, designs, and drawings according to VDOT standards and guidelines. -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ams, including planners, engineers, contractors, and local agencies.

What You Bring
-4-7 years of experience in transportation engineering, including design and project management. -Professional Engineer (PE) license or Engineer-In-Training (EIT) with the intention to obtain a PE within 1 year is required -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. -Proficiency in OpenRoads Designer is required -Excellent communication and teamwork abilities. -Bach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ering, Transportation Engineering, or a related field. -Knowledge of VDOT standards, specifications, and project delivery processes is required.
